Finally found what I was looking for (even in this empty universe)
Listened to at least 3 episode-by-episode podcasts following season 1 of True Detective before finding this one. Lo and behold, my search is over! The first season of the TV anthology is so multilayered, only a podcast as thoughtful as this one can really do it justice. The hosts go way beyond plot recaps and talk about performances and direction (though that's in there too.) But these guys also have a really strong appreciationg for narrative, symbolism, and critical analysis that helps listeners delve deep into the lore of the show. Sound overly profound? Not so, as the hosts somehow manage to keep things light. They're both likeable and funny, and make even the darkest monologues of Rust Cohle seem not so depressing thanks to their even approach and upbeat delivery.
